What is Research Delivery Performance?

We closely follow the National Institute for Health Research (NIHR) guidelines for ‘research delivery performance’ for NHS research.

Research delivery performance aims to measure the effective delivery and support of clinical trials in NHS services by:

  • Understanding how quickly services are recruiting patients to clinical trials.
  • Reviewing their recruitment against contractual agreements.

Why does it matter?

Research delivery performance information is collected across all organisations supporting the delivery of clinical trials. This allows organisations to compare how well they are doing against other organisations in their area, allowing them to collaborate and share best practice to increase the number of patients participating in research. This also helps identify AWP and the local area as an appealing place to host and deliver research.
